Q: What type of clothing is best to wear for a Pilates session?

A: Comfortable, close-fitting clothing that will stay close to your body as you move, such

as leggings and elasticized materials are best, similar to what you might wear in a pilates

class. If you prefer shorts, best to have biker-type shorts either alone or underneath a

looser pair.

Q: What do I wear on my feet?

A: You need to have a good connection with your feet without slipping. Barefoot is fine,

or grippy socks that are tight to your feet with plenty of ‘grippies’ on the bottom. For

the TRX class, you want to wear sneakers with a low heel. You may bring them with you,

so they are ‘clean’ for class. This will keep less dirt on the carpet and on the BOSU’s and

is very appreciated!

Q: Do I need a towel?

A: Generally, you do not perspire a great deal in Pilates, however, occasionally you

might. If you tend to get very warm, then a small absorbent towel is recommended.
